K&L SA here. They no-offered across multiple offices, including the flagship Pittsburgh office. In my office, it certainly didn't seem like it was due to any major faux pas of the SAs (yes, multiple with an S) in question, but rather they just seem to be ok with hiring SAs and no-offering some. Really nice people otherwise, but it's a douchey thing to do. I wouldn't gamble with your future but YMMV.

Anonymous User wrote: Ya I'm just trying to make sure I have as much info as possible. So in your opinion are the people being no-offered deserving of it or does it seem almost random? I'd hate to seem to be doing well and end up with no offer. Referring to NY office specifically
Yeah, understood, looking at overall trends is helpful as well. At my office it seemed a mix of "deserving" the no-offer (if by deserving you mean less than average work quality - there were definitely no major workplace/social no-nos committed by the person to my knowledge) and random (I can't imagine what the other people I have in mind did to deserve it, they seemed quite professional / competent).

This is with the caveat that I was not in the NY office. I'd try as hard as possible to find alum of your school that summered there this year, or if you get the offer then ask these types of tough questions during the 2nd look.
